Thetha Nami: participatory development of a peer-navigator intervention to deliver biosocial HIV prevention for adolescents and youth in rural South Africa.

Maryam ShahmaneshNonhlanhla OkesolaNatsayi ChimbindiThembelihle ZumaSakhile MdluliNondumiso MthiyaneOluwafemi AdeagboJaco DreyerCarina HerbstNuala McGrathGuy HarlingLorraine SherrJanet Seeley
Published in: BMC public health (2021)
Local youth were able to use evidence to develop a contextually adapted peer-led intervention to deliver biosocial HIV prevention.
